Beth Krom Wants Toll Road Agency To Adopt "Living Wage"
Posted by: Jubal | 06/04/2008 2:07 PM
The advantage of being a liberal is that when it comes to "social justice," money is no object -- especially when it's not your own.
Case in point: at today's meeting of the Foothill/Eastern Corridor Transportation Agency's finance committee, the topic of their janitorial contract arose.
This prompted Irvine Mayor Beth Krom to announce that they ought to imitate the progressive example of Irvine and impose a "living wage" requirement on all F/ECTA contractors.
That would mean anyone doing business with the F/ETCA would have to pay all their employees whatever F/ETCA considered too be a "living wage" -- regardless of whether those employees were actually working on F/ETCA projects.
Krom's brainstorm was met with a resounding silence -- understandable since the rest of the committee members are possessed of common sense and live in the real world.
